Transaction bd10b2e3156ba105d393085d0eb7573a6762857a846c519d5230ffe36519060e
1 Input
1 Output
-
bd10b2e3156ba105d393085d0eb7573a6762857a846c519d5230ffe36519060e:0
- value
- 20788648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 940731876fbb2a2a550f5298c73264e25c6f1190 OP_EQUAL
- address
- 3FBiYkDVxAupk9GQE4NrwNkd7tXyokTiyF